Steps:
- Melt butter in a saucepan.
- Sprinkle in flour.
- Add milk.
- Stir until thickened.
- Add grated cheese.
- Pour mixture over beaten egg yolks.
- Fold in beaten egg whites.
- Pour into buttered ramekins.
- Run thumb around lip of ramekins.
- Bake for exactly 30 minutes at 350 degrees.
